package mapping
import (
"fmt"
"io/ioutil"
"net"
"time"
etime "github.com/DevFactory/go-tools/pkg/extensions/time"
"github.com/DevFactory/go-tools/pkg/nettools"
nt "github.com/DevFactory/go-tools/pkg/nettools"
"github.com/sirupsen/logrus"
"github.com/DevFactory/go-tools/pkg/linux/command"
)
const (
interfaceMarkStart = 0x0800
)
// IPRouteSmartNatHelper is a customized nettools.IPRouteProvider,
// which supports auto-refreshing of ip addresses and routes
type IPRouteSmartNatHelper interface {
EnsureOnlyOneIPRuleExistsForFwMark(rule nettools.IPRule) ([]nettools.IPRule, time.Duration, error)
etime.Refresher
}
type ipRouteSmartNatHelper struct {
nettools.IPRouteHelper
etime.Refresher
}
// NewIPRouteSmartNatHelper creates IPRouteSmartNatHelper with periodic autorefreshing for them
func NewIPRouteSmartNatHelper(routeHelperExecutor command.Executor, routeHelperIoOp nettools.SimpleFileOperator,
ifaceProvider nettools.InterfaceProvider, refreshPeriod time.Duration, gwAddressOffset int32) IPRouteSmartNatHelper {
ipRouteHelper := nettools.NewExecIPRouteHelper(routeHelperExecutor, routeHelperIoOp)
action := initRefreshAction(ipRouteHelper, ifaceProvider, gwAddressOffset)
refresher := etime.NewTickerRefresher(action, true, true, refreshPeriod)
return &ipRouteSmartNatHelper{
IPRouteHelper: ipRouteHelper,
Refresher: refresher,
}
}
// NewChanIPRouteSmartNatHelper creates IPRouteSmartNatHelper with routing rules refresh
// ran every time there's a new message on the update channel
func NewChanIPRouteSmartNatHelper(ipRouteHelper nettools.IPRouteHelper, ifaceProvider nettools.InterfaceProvider,
updateChan chan time.Time, refreshOnCreate bool, gwAddressOffset int32) IPRouteSmartNatHelper {
action := initRefreshAction(ipRouteHelper, ifaceProvider, gwAddressOffset)
refresher := etime.NewRefresher(updateChan, action, refreshOnCreate, true)
return &ipRouteSmartNatHelper{
IPRouteHelper: ipRouteHelper,
Refresher: refresher,
}
}
func initRefreshAction(ipRouteHelper nettools.IPRouteHelper,
ifaceProvider nettools.InterfaceProvider, gwAddressOffset int32) func() {
ifaceProvider.StartRefreshing()
action := func() {
runReloading(ifaceProvider, ipRouteHelper, gwAddressOffset)
}
return action
}
func runReloading(ifaceProvider nettools.InterfaceProvider, routeHelper nettools.IPRouteHelper, gwAddressOffset int32) {
logrus.Debug("Starting to reload interfaces and ip route")
ifaces, err := ifaceProvider.Interfaces()
if err != nil {
logrus.Errorf("Error reloading information about interfaces, not updating routing rules: %v", err)
return
}
logrus.Debug("Passing loaded interfaces to IPRouteHelper")
if _, err := routeHelper.InitializeRoutingTablesPerInterface(ifaces); err != nil {
logrus.Errorf("Error refreshing routing rules based on interface info passed: %v", err)
}
if err := disableRpFilter("all"); err != nil {
logrus.Errorf("Error when disabling rp_filter for 'all': %v", err)
}
logrus.Debug("Starting to configure network interfaces")
for _, iface := range ifaces {
logrus.Debugf("Processing interface %s", iface.GetName())
if err := disableRpFilter(iface.GetName()); err != nil {
logrus.Warnf("Error when disabling rp_filter on interface %s: %v", iface.GetName(), err)
continue
}
mark := getFwMarkForInterface(iface)
rule := nettools.IPRule{
FwMark: mark,
RouteTableName: iface.GetName(),
}
if _, _, err := routeHelper.EnsureOnlyOneIPRuleExistsForFwMark(rule); err != nil {
logrus.Errorf("Error setting up ip routing rule for interface %s and mark %x: %v", iface.GetName(),
mark, err)
}
addrs, err := iface.Addrs()
if err != nil {
logrus.Warnf("Couldn't list addresses of interface %s: %v", iface.GetName(), err)
continue
}
if len(addrs) == 0 {
logrus.Warnf("Interface %s has no IPs assigned, won't generate any routing entries in its route table",
iface.GetName())
continue
}
if err := setupRouteEntries(routeHelper, iface, gwAddressOffset); err != nil {
logrus.Errorf("Error setting up route entries for interface %s in route table %s: %v", iface.GetName(),
iface.GetName(), err)
}
}
logrus.Debug("Interfaces and ip route reload done")
}
func setupRouteEntries(routeHelper nettools.IPRouteHelper, iface nettools.Interface, gwAddressOffset int32) error {
addrs, _ := iface.Addrs()
addr := addrs[0]
logrus.Debugf("Configuring routing on interface %s based on address %s", iface.GetName(), addr.String())
localSubnet := net.IPNet{
IP: addr.IP.Mask(addr.Mask),
Mask: addr.Mask,
}
logrus.Debugf("Detected subnet address: %s", localSubnet.String())
logrus.Debugf("Getting gateway address using offset: %d", gwAddressOffset)
gwIP, err := nt.OffsetAddr(localSubnet, gwAddressOffset)
if err != nil {
logrus.Errorf("Error getting offset of %d from IP %v: %v", gwAddressOffset, gwIP, err)
return err
}
logrus.Debugf("Detected gateway address: %s", gwIP.String())
routeEntries := []nt.IPRouteEntry{
{
TableName: iface.GetName(),
TargetPrefix: localSubnet.String(),
Mode: "dev",
Gateway: iface.GetName(),
Options: "scope link",
},
{
TableName: iface.GetName(),
TargetPrefix: "default",
Mode: "via",
Gateway: gwIP.String(),
Options: fmt.Sprintf("dev %s", iface.GetName()),
},
}
if _, err := routeHelper.EnsureRoutes(routeEntries); err != nil {
logrus.Errorf("Error adding route entries in table %s, with local subnet %s and gw %s; error: %v",
iface.GetName(), localSubnet.String(), gwIP.String(), err)
return err
}
return nil
}
func getFwMarkForInterface(iface nettools.Interface) int {
return interfaceMarkStart + iface.GetIndex()
}
func disableRpFilter(ifaceName string) error {
path := fmt.Sprintf("/proc/sys/net/ipv4/conf/%s/rp_filter", ifaceName)
return ioutil.WriteFile(path, []byte("0"), 0644)
}
